Hunting
After the Timberwolves opened the meeting, we fell in for the Hunting program, which has presented by Jimmy Ritzman. He began by discussing apparel, which he said was "just like winter camping, except only one day". The clothes he displayed were mostly camouflage, except those that were bright orange. Orange must be worn to legally hunt with a gun. He emphasized the importance of hats and boots to wear.

He also mentioned several other necessities. First, a good knife, which "should be sharp enough to cut hair"; rope, which you need to take the gun up into the tree, and to drag the deer to your vehicle; and the 'pee bottle', which you relive yourself into so the deer do not scent you. Deer have a good sense of smell.
He mentioned how, when you shoot a deer, the best place to hit it is on the shoulder blade, because all the vital organs are back there. You can shoot does in the head, but you don't want to on bucks, because it wrecks the trophy.

To get a hunting license, you must take a course, and then pass a test. Jimmy quoted one question from the test, "What is a safety?" (on a gun) The answer they wanted was, "A mechanical device that can and will fail".
